West Indian Captain Darren Sammy optimistic ahead of Test Series against Pakistan
Captain of the West Indies team, Darren Sammy, appeared confident ahead of the first Test Series against Pakistan and claimed that his side will enter the tournament with a belief to win.
"We believe we can win the series," assured the West Indies captain.
The skipper trusts his team’s abilities and believes that they have the advantage of performing on their home grounds.
"We believe this because we have worked hard in the build-up to the series and we know we have the ability to perform on home turf and get the better of Pakistan. We saw an improved batting performance in the last two matches of the
one-day series and everyone in the team is feeling confident and fully prepared,” said Sammy.
He promised that his side will retain their match-winning composure that they developed in the last two wins in the one day internationals.
"We fought back really well to win the last two matches in the one-day format and we will take that momentum and belief into the Test matches. Test cricket is a different form of cricket, so we know we have to make the adjustment,”
Sammy affirmed.
West Indies struggled with the bat in the first three ODI fixtures. However, the batting line up gained momentum with the induction of veteran http://www.senore.com/Cricket/Shivnarine-Chanderpaul-c90073.
His men will try to establish a firm footing at the crease and score heavy totals in order to tackle the opponents. The bowling lineup will perform wisely and aim their deliveries in the right areas to restrict http://www.senore.com/Cricket/Pakistan-c755’s batting total.
With pace man Fidel Edwards making a comeback after 2 years of absence from cricket due to a back injury, http://www.senore.com/Cricket/West-Indies-c760’ bowling line up appears stronger than before.  
Leg spinner Devendra Bishoo, who claimed 11 wickets in the 5-match One Day International series to emerge as the top wicket-taker, is all set to play his Test debut.
Sammy assured that irrespective of the team composition the players will do a brilliant job in the Test series.
While praising the Men in http://www.senore.com/Cricket/Green-c60723, he added that the Windies side will offer stiff competition to the tough contenders on the Guyana pitch that appears to be similar to the ODI track.
